Pregunta

¿Por qué JQuery Risizable () no cambia el tamaño del ancho y la altura de la ID de contención asignada a él? Puedes probarlo en http://jsfiddle.net/c8ysu/6/ Y mira lo que quiero decir. Intente cambiar el tamaño del DIV creado, no cambiará el tamaño a un ancho y altura total en el padre #Container Div. Esto parece ser causado por el draggable() función.

¿Fue útil?

Solución

Agregar una posición relativa al #Container Div solucionó el problema.

Otros consejos

<script type="text/javascript">
        $("button").click(function () {
            var elm = $('<div id="divId" class="adiv abs"></div>');
            elm.appendTo('#container').resizable({
                containment: "parent"
            });
        });
    </script>

Actualizar

<script>
        $("button").click(function () {
            var elm = $('<div id="divId" class="adiv abs"></div>');
            elm.appendTo('#container').draggable({
                snap: true,
                containment: 'parent'
            }).resizable({
                maxWidth: 300,
                maxHeight: 300
            });
        });

</script>

Es un problema al agregar draggable a él.

Prueba este ejemplo. Eliminado arrastrable, pero agregó manijas.

http://jsfiddle.net/c8ysu/7/

Licenciado bajo: CC-BY-SA con atribución
No afiliado a StackOverflow
scroll top